Telangana High Court (TSHC) has released the Telangana High Court Exam Hall Ticket 2026 on 22nd August 2026 on its official website https://tshc.gov.in. Candidates who have registered for 319 vacancies for Office Subordinate and 95 vacancies for Process Server posts can now download their admit card using login credentials: User ID and Password.
Telangana High Court Exam Hall Ticket 2026- Highlights
| Particular | Details |
| Exam Name | Telangana High Court CBT Exam |
| Hall Ticket Release Date | 22nd August 2026 |
| Exam Date | 29th and 30th August 2026 |
| Advt. No. | 8/2026, 9/2026, 101/2026 |
| Mode of Hall Ticket | Online |
| Login Details | User ID and Password |
| Mode of Exam | Online (Computer Based Mode) |
| Negative Marking | No |

TS District Court Exam Timing
The Telangana High Court has announced that the Computer-Based Examination for the posts of Office Subordinate & Process Server will be conducted in 3 shifts. The test shift details are given below:
| Advt. No. | Post Name | Exam Date | Shift Timing |
| 8/2026 | Office Subordinate | 29th August 2026 | 10 am to 11 am |
| 9/2026 | Process Server | 29th August 2026 | 2 pm to 3 pm |
| 101/2026 | Office Subordinate | 30th August 2026 | 11 am to 12 noon |

Telangana District Court Exam Pattern 2026
- The Telangana District Court Exam consists of 100 objective type multiple type questions.
- The exam will be held for a total of 100 marks.
- The duration of the exam is 120 minutes.
| Subjects | Total Questions | Total Marks | Time Duration |
| General Knowledge | 60 | 60 | 120 minutes |
| General English | 40 | 40 | |
| Total | 100 | 100 |
Minimum Qualifying Marks
- OC/EWS: 40%
- BC: 35%
- SC/ST/PH: 30%
Selection Stages for Telangana District Court Recruitment 2026
The selection process for the Telangana District Court Exam includes the following stages.
- First Stage – OMR-based Written Examination
- Second Stage – Viva Voce (Interview)
- Third Stage – Document Verification
